Question:

The given table represents the population of different villages.

Name of the Village Number of Males Number of Females
A 1500 1220
B 1460 1320
C 1105 1180
D 1305 1170

J : denotes the average number of males in villages A, B and C.

K: denotes the average number of females in villages B, C and D.

What is the average of J and K?

Options:

1289.17

1279.62

1278.36

1288.62

Correct Answer:

1289.17

Explanation:

J : denotes the average number of males in villages A, B and C.

= \(\frac{1500 + 1460 + 1105}{3}\)

= \(\frac{4065}{3}\)

= 1355

K: denotes the average number of females in villages B, C and D

= \(\frac{1320 + 1180 + 1170}{3}\) 

= \(\frac{3670}{3}\) 

= 1223.33

Average of J & K = \(\frac{1355 + 1223.33}{2}\) 

= 1289.17
